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Wymondham to Ystrad Mynach start from as little as £27.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Wymondham to Ystrad Mynach start from £166.60 one way, or £167.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Wymondham to Ystrad Mynach are available for £222.80 one way, or £374.50 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Station Details and Facilities

First and foremost, it’s worth noting that Wymondham station does not have a traditional ticket office, but fear not! Ticket machines are available on site, functioning not just for purchases but also for collecting tickets bought online. These machines are accessible to all, with an induction loop available for those who need it.

However, you’ll want to plan ahead as there are no luggage storage facilities and waiting rooms are unavailable. Seating areas are ready for use, but remember to dress warmly in inclement weather. The station does benefit from CCTV for enhanced security, but lacks a car park surveillance system. However, parking is secured at an affordable rate of £3 daily.

Accessibility and Support on Offer

Accessibility is crucial, and Wymondham station tries to meet these needs with varying degrees of success. Step-free access is available on Platform 1, catering to trains towards Norwich. Unfortunately, Platform 2 is only reachable via a footbridge, a poignant reminder for those who require step-free access throughout their journey. Assistance is available upon request, in advance of travel, using Passenger Assist—a great initiative to ensure everyone can travel confidently and comfortably.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

Wymondham station caters to onward travel with a rail replacement bus service picking up and dropping off conveniently at the junction of Station Rd and Cemetery Lane. Though local taxi and car hire services are available, there are no accessible taxis stationed here. Therefore, it’s advisable for those with mobility concerns to plan these journeys in advance.

Ystrad Mynach train station, situated in the heart of Caerphilly, Wales, is your gateway to the scenic Rhymney Valley. Its charming location offers a unique experience for travelers, whether you're commuting for work or embarking on a leisurely escape. A key station on the Rhymney Line, Ystrad Mynach provides regular services to Cardiff and beyond, making it an essential link in the Welsh rail network.

Station Facilities and Ticketing Options

When you set foot in Ystrad Mynach station, you'll find convenient ticket buying options. The ticket office is open on weekdays from 06:30 to 13:00 and on Saturdays from 08:00 to 14:30, perfect for early morning travelers.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are available and allow for online ticket collection. However, it's worth noting that machines do not accept cash, so be sure to have your debit or credit card handy.

This station takes accessibility seriously, offering step-free access throughout. There are lifts available for access to Platform 1 towards Cardiff, and a direct step-free route from the car park to Platform 2 heading to Rhymney. With customers' ease and movement in mind, induction loops are provided, and ramps are available for train access, although facilities like waiting rooms and accessible toilets are lacking.

Amenities and Support Services

Ystrad Mynach station offers essential services such as customer help points and information from staff at the ticket office and help points. CCTV coverage ensures added security, although there is no dedicated luggage storage facility. For those tech-savvy travelers, public Wi-Fi is accessible, giving you the chance to keep connected while you travel. You can explore other hotspots near the station on various Wi-Fi services.

Parking and Cycling

The station car park, open 24 hours daily, accommodates 34 spaces, with three designated for accessible parking, and it's free of charge. For cycling enthusiasts, Ystrad Mynach provides 36 bicycle spaces with covered and secure stands monitored by CCTV. While there are no cycle hire facilities, these amenities support environmentally friendly travel options.

Transport Links and Travel Options

The station's connection doesn't end with the train. Rail replacement bus services use the Blackwood Link bus stop in the station's car park, ensuring smooth transitions to different travel modes.
